Firefox balances privacy with performance by collecting limited data, such as usage trends, crash reports, and system details, to improve stability and functionality. This article provides an overview of what’s included in your system settings, where you can control data collection and usage across Android or iOS.

Manage sponsored content data and recent activity

  1. Open Firefox and tap the menu button ≡ at the bottom of the screen.
  2. Select Settings, navigate to the following to adjust your preferences:
    • For Search Suggestions, go to General > Search and scroll down to Address bar > Firefox Suggest > Suggestions from Sponsors – Provides the ability to turn on or off sponsored search suggestions.
    • For Sponsored Stories, go to General > Homepage and scroll down to Include on Homepage > Thought-Provoking Stories – Provides the ability to turn on or off sponsored stories on New Tab.
    • For Sponsored Shortcuts, go to Homepage > Shortcuts > Sponsored Shortcuts – Provides the ability to turn on or off sponsored shortcuts on a New Tab.
    • For Shortcuts, go to Homepage > Shortcuts > Shortcuts – Provides the ability to turn on or off icons displaying recent downloads, sites or bookmarks.

Manage sponsored content data and recent activity

  1. Open Firefox and tap the 3-dot menu button on the right of your toolbar.
  2. Select Settings, navigate to the following to adjust your preferences:
    • For Search Suggestions, go to General > Search and scroll down to Address bar – Firefox Suggest > Suggestions from Sponsors – Provides the ability to turn on or off sponsored search suggestions.
    • For Sponsored Stories, go to General > Homepage and scroll down to Include on Homepage > Thought-Provoking Stories – Provides the ability to turn on or off sponsored stories on a New Tab.
    • For Shortcuts, go to General > Homepage > Shortcuts – Provides the ability to turn on or off tiles displaying recent downloads, sites or bookmarks.
    • For Sponsored Shortcuts, go to General > Homepage > Shortcuts > Sponsored Shortcuts – Provides the ability to turn on or off sponsored shortcuts on a New Tab.
